Councilman Davis Facing Financial AllegationsBuffalo Police confirm for Eyewitness News, they are investigating allegations that Buffalo Common Councilman Brian Davis has been accused of writing a bad check for several thousand dollars. Buffalo Police aren't releasing many details, but admitted they are looking into it. "First and foremost this is an allegation that police have been looking into, are looking into. It's my understanding that detectives working the case are scheduled to meet with both sides in this matter trying to determine wether this is a civil case or a criminal matter. But I want to caution everyone, at this point, that no one has been arrested. At this time it remains an allegation, at this point." said police spokesperson Mike DeGeorge. We did try to reach Davis on this issue. He was not at Tuesday's common council meeting. We also went to his office and he was not in. We did call his office and cell phone several times. Davis has not returned our calls. Eyewitness News was contacted by a member of Councilman Davis' staff. We were told he is out on medical leave by a doctor's order and will return February 17th.
